GOODNIGHT NELLIE Trainer: Andy Mathis Last race: March 7, 3rd Finish: 1st by 3 1/2 Beyer: 63 Debut 4-year-old filly broke last in Cal-bred maiden-claiming sprint, sped to midpack, took dirt, angled three wide, ran away. Nice win despite start, fits in starter allowance.    ANDREADYTORUMBLE Trainer: Andy Mathis Last race: March 8, 1st Finish: 6th by 17 1/4 Beyer: 51 Gelding fractious in gate of N2L claiming turf route, re-loaded, broke slowly, lagged, misfired. GEM MINE Trainer: Richard Baltas Last race: March 8, 3rd Finish: 7th by 7 1/4 Beyer: 59 Pace-press claiming mare not quick in turf sprint, steadied, unable to establish forward position, raced wide and faltered. This was a toss, she fits in N3L claiming turf sprint.   SEXZIE Trainer: Mark Galtt Last race: March 8, 4th Finish: 6th by 12 3/4 Beyer: 39 Debut 3-year-old filly bet to odds-on, but everything went wrong. Not quick, rank and tossed head taking dirt, misfired. She trained better than she ran, and can be followed.   MORNING ADDICTION Trainer: Javier Sierra Last race: March 8, 6th Finish: 5th by 5 1/4 Beyer: 46 Claiming veteran shuffled and lost position backstretch, raced wide on turn, went flat. Inconclusive effort by 8-year-old with 11 wins; fits in low-level claiming sprint.   LEAD PIPE JOE Trainer: Andy Mathis Last race: March 8, 7th Finish: 1st by 8 Beyer: 74 Class-drop maiden settled fourth, split rivals into lane, ran away by many, claimed by Mathis from trainer Luis Mendez. Eligible to starter allowance, threat right back.   WOUND UP Trainer: Librado Barocio Last race: March 9, 2nd Finish: 1st by 6 1/2 Beyer: 99 Veteran gelding scored eighth career win, and fourth straight, in fast starter allowance sprint. Wound Up, next-to-last in 2022 Breeders’ Cup Juvenile, has never been better.    MACKINNON Trainer: Doug O’Neill Last race: March 9, 11th Finish: 5th by 2 Beyer: 85 Comeback stakes winner making first start in seven months needed the race.
